本文提供了一份从零开始制作私人AI模型全面指南,旨在帮助读者打造个性化的AI助手。需要选择合适的AI框架和编程语言,如TensorFlow、PyTorch等,并了解基本的机器学习概念。选择合适的AI模型类型,如监督学习、无监督学习等,并收集和预处理数据集。在模型训练阶段,需要设置适当的参数和优化器,并使用交叉验证等技术来提高模型的准确性和泛化能力。进行模型评估和部署,使用测试集评估模型性能,并选择合适的部署方式(如云服务、本地服务器等)。文章还强调了隐私和安全问题,建议使用加密和安全协议来保护用户数据和模型安全。通过遵循这份指南,读者可以打造出符合自己需求的个性化AI助手,提高工作效率和准确性。

在科技飞速发展的今天,人工智能(AI)已经渗透到我们生活的方方面面,无论是智能家居、智能客服,还是个性化推荐系统,AI正以各种形式改变着我们的世界,对于那些希望拥有独一无二、高度定制化AI助手的人来说,自己动手制作一个私人AI模型无疑是一个既兴奋又充满挑战的旅程,本文将引导你从零开始,一步步构建你自己的私人AI模型。

一、前期准备:理解需求与工具选择

在开始之前,首先需要明确你的AI助手将用于哪些具体任务,比如日程管理、知识问答、情感陪伴或是特定领域的专业咨询等,明确需求后,选择合适的工具和框架至关重要,对于初学者,推荐使用Python语言结合TensorFlow或PyTorch等开源框架,这些工具资源丰富、社区支持强大,易于上手。

二、数据收集与预处理

数据是AI模型的“粮食”,根据你AI助手的定位,收集相关数据,如果目标是情感陪伴,可能需要收集大量对话数据;若为专业知识问答,则需聚焦于特定领域的知识库,数据预处理包括清洗、去重、格式统一等步骤,确保数据质量直接影响模型性能。

三、模型设计与训练

1、选择模型架构:基于你的需求,选择合适的神经网络架构,对于初学者,可以从简单的循环神经网络(RNN)或长短期记忆网络(LSTM)开始,它们在处理序列数据(如对话)时表现良好。

打造个性化AI助手,从零开始制作私人AI模型的全面指南

2、划分数据集:将数据集分为训练集、验证集和测试集,通常比例为70%、15%、15%,这有助于评估模型在不同情况下的表现,并指导超参数调整。

3、模型训练:利用选定的框架和工具进行模型训练,这一过程包括设置学习率、批处理大小、迭代次数等超参数,以及可能的正则化技术(如dropout)来防止过拟合。

4、调优与测试:通过调整超参数、增加层数或改变激活函数等方式优化模型性能,使用验证集监控训练过程,确保模型在未见过的数据上也能表现良好。

四、部署与交互界面设计

1、模型部署:训练完成后,将模型部署到服务器或本地机器上,确保用户可以通过合适的接口与之交互,对于Web应用,可以使用Flask或Django等框架快速搭建API。

2、交互界面:设计直观易用的用户界面(UI),可以是网页、移动应用或简单的命令行界面,确保用户能够以自然语言或预设指令与AI助手进行交流。

五、持续优化与维护

用户反馈循环:鼓励用户提供反馈,不断收集使用过程中的问题和建议,以此为基础对模型进行迭代优化。

安全与隐私:确保AI助手的运行符合数据保护法规,特别是涉及用户个人信息的处理时需格外小心。

技术更新:随着技术的进步,定期检查并应用新的算法和框架以提高模型效率和准确性。

制作一个私人AI模型不仅是一个技术挑战,更是一次探索未知的旅程,它要求你从零开始理解数据、设计算法、构建系统并最终将其呈现给用户,在这个过程中,你将学会如何将抽象的概念转化为可执行的代码,体验到从失败中学习的乐趣以及成功带来的满足感,更重要的是,这将是一个不断成长和进步的过程,随着你对AI技术的深入理解,你的私人AI助手也将变得更加智能、更加贴心,最好的AI不仅仅是技术的堆砌,更是对人类需求深刻理解的体现,通过不懈努力和持续优化,你将拥有一个真正独一无二、为你量身定制的AI伙伴。